My mom lives very close by and we happened to see the sign about a new Thai restaurant to the street so we decided to give it a shot.
We went in at about 8:30pm on a Saturday night and we had the restaurant to our selves, although Oh told us it was packed an hour earlier.
The restaurant is clean and has great lighting and decor. While we were reviewing the menu she brought us a basket of still sizzling rice chips that were so good!
We decided to order the Pad Thai and Yellow Curry. Both arrived hot and beautifully presented.
The Pad Thai was full of flavor and the shrimp were plentiful. The Yellow Curry was just what I was craving, the chicken was tender and the veggies were cooked perfectly.
I will say that nothing here has much heat to it, so ask for added spice if that is what you like.
They are waiting on a liquor licence (either beer & wine or BYOB).
They also have lunch specials for $6.95...
